Tom Petty Estate Unveils Ultra-Limited Stormy "Cool Blue" Vinyl

The Tom Petty Estate today announces the surprise release of a vinyl store exclusive in stormy "Cool Blue." This mottled version of The Live Anthology – From The Vaults Vol. 1 is an ultra-limited edition pressing available for purchase HERE.

A special treat for fans with tracks chosen by the man himself. A total of just 2,000 individually numbered copies will be made available.

These recordings capture an intimate and powerful portrait of Tom Petty & The Heartbreakers legendary onstage performances featuring a dynamic deep track set list featuring "Like A Diamond," "Think About Me," and "Ballad of Easy Rider" and more.

Tom's personally curated disc was originally included as the final bonus disc in a limited edition 5CD box of The Live Anthology (a 2009 Best Buy–exclusive) and has never before been available as a standalone vinyl release.

On Black Friday, fans were able to purchase the turquoise version of Petty's archival vision, retailed exclusively at indie record stores with a pressing of 11,000 internationally.

Over his 40-year career, Tom Petty became a beloved American rock & roll icon, world renowned for his songwriting and his incredible band the Heartbreakers. In addition to the 13 studio albums he made with the Heartbreakers, Petty recorded three solo albums, including the acclaimed Full Moon Fever, Wildflowers and Highway Companion. Petty was also a member of the supergroup Traveling Wilburys and in the pre-Heartbreakers band Mudcrutch.

Hailed as one of the greatest rock music artists of all time, Petty's honors include Songwriters Hall of Fame, Rock & Roll Hall of Fame and multiple Grammy Awards. He has sold over 85 million records, amassed over five billion streams and performed to over 140 million fans worldwide. Widely recognized and remembered for his philanthropy and service, Petty is the recipient of some of the highest honors in philanthropy including Midnight Mission's Golden Heart Award in 2011, and MusicCares 'Person of the Year' in 2017.

The Petty Estate aims to extend the late artist's legacy, both musically and in spirit, by supporting philanthropic and social issues that were close to Petty's heart. Earlier this year the Estate provided financial support to 10 families in partnership with GoFundMe, as well as MusiCares and Healthcare for Homeless Animals in the aftermath of the Los Angeles Wildfires. Additionally, the Estate were sponsors for this year's NYC Pride as well as LGBTQIA+ nonprofit youth organization It Gets Better.

Tom Petty passed away in 2017 shortly after completing his 40th anniversary tour, leaving behind a massive archive of unreleased material. His music continues to reach fans, both new and old, around the world today.
